目录 前言:一、MySQL架构总览:二、查询执行流程1.连接2.处理3.结果三、SQL解析顺序准备工作 1.创建测试数据库 2.创建测试表 3.插入数据 4.最后想要的结果!现在开始SQL解析之旅吧!1. FROM(1-J2)ON过滤(1-J3)添加外部列前言: 一直是想知道一条SQL语句是怎么被执行的,它执行的顺序是怎样的,然后查看总结各方资料,就有了下面这一篇博文了。 本
转载
2024-10-15 20:10:42
20阅读
利用二进制还原数据库的时候,突然有点纠结,log_bin和sql_log_bin有什么区别呢?行吧,搜搜,结合自己的经验,简单说一下。log_bin:二进制日志。在 mysql 启动时,通过命令行或配置文件决定是否开启 binlog,而 log_bin 这个变量仅仅是报告当前 binlog 系统的状态(打开与否)。若你想要关闭 binlog,你可以通过修改 sql_log_bin 并把原来的连接
转载
2023-11-06 12:55:31
651阅读
## MySQL如何禁止生成bin日志
在某些情况下,MySQL的bin日志(binary log)可能会导致一些不必要的问题,例如占用过多的磁盘空间或影响性能。在此,我们将探讨如何禁止MySQL生成bin日志,并介绍一个具体问题的解决方案。
### 1. 什么是bin日志?
bin日志是MySQL用于记录所有更改数据库结构或内容操作的日志。当启用bin日志时,MySQL会将每个DML操作(
在本文中,我们将针对“hanlp生成bin”,这个在自然语言处理领域中经常遇到的问题进行深入探讨。我们将通过一系列的结构化环节,详细记录问题的解决过程,包括环境预检、部署架构、安装过程、依赖管理、服务验证以及版本管理。让我们一起来看看具体的步骤和细节吧!
## 环境预检
首先,在开始之前,我们需要确保环境配置是合适的。下面是我们所需的硬件配置:
| 硬件项目 | 规格 |
|
如果想在主库上执行一些操作,但不复制到slave库上,可以通过修改参数sql_log_bin来实现。 比如想在主库上修改某个表的定义,但是在slave库上不做修改: 要慎重使用global修饰符(set global sql_log_bin=0),这样会导致所有在Master数据库上执行的语句都不记
转载
2016-07-01 16:10:00
210阅读
2评论
# MySQL重启与二进制日志重新生成
MySQL是一种开源的关系型数据库管理系统,在数据库的管理与维护过程中,重启数据库是常进行的一项操作。在重启MySQL数据库时,二进制日志(binary log)的重新生成是一个重要的问题。本文将介绍MySQL的重启过程以及二进制日志的管理,最后提供代码示例和状态图来帮助大家更好地理解。
## 什么是二进制日志?
二进制日志是MySQL的一个重要特性,
# MySQL 不生成 bin.log 文件
## 介绍
在MySQL中,bin.log文件是二进制日志文件,用于记录每个被执行的语句或者更改。bin.log文件对于数据库的恢复和复制非常重要。然而,有时候我们可能不希望MySQL生成bin.log文件,本文将介绍如何实现这个目标。
## 方法一:关闭二进制日志
最简单的方法是直接关闭MySQL的二进制日志功能。可以通过修改MySQL配置文
原创
2023-07-31 12:57:02
1501阅读
MySQL 的二进制日志 binlog 可以说是 MySQL 最重要的日志,它记录了所有的 DDL 和 DML 语句(除了数据查询语句select、show等),以事件形式记录,还包含语句所执行的消耗的时间,MySQL的二进制日志是事务安全型的。binlog 的主要目的是复制和恢复。一、打开:1、登录mysql之后使用下面的命令查看是否开启binlogsho
转载
2023-06-05 10:17:14
153阅读
mysql参数sql_log_bin配置如果想在主库上执行一些操作,但不复制到slave库上,可以通过修改参数sql_log_bin来实现。比如想在主库上修改某个表的定义,但是在slave库上不做修改:master mysql> set sql_log_bin=0;#设为0后,在Master数据库上执行的语句都不记录binlogmaster mysql> alter ta...
转载
2021-08-09 16:27:21
922阅读
mysql参数sql_log_bin配置如果想在主库上执行一些操作,但不复制到Master数据库上执行的语句都不记录binlogmaster mysql> alter ta...
转载
2022-04-11 15:30:10
916阅读
SQLServer脚本生成工具是一款用于SQLServer表生成Insert脚本的工具,可以快速的为您自动生成脚本,而且格式规范,可自动生成也可以手动生成。。相关软件软件大小版本说明下载地址SQL Server脚本生成工具是一款用于SQLServer表生成Insert脚本的工具,可以快速的为您自动生成脚本,而且格式规范,可自动生成也可以手动生成。基本简介QL脚本是使用一种规定SQL语言,依据SQL
转载
2023-10-17 21:40:15
61阅读
(1)在options->linker ->output->other选中->output里选择raw-binary,module-local里选择Include all,其余默认; (2) options->linker ->Extra Output->generate output file->format->output format
原创
2013-09-15 19:23:43
4192阅读
fromelf --bincombined -o "$L@L.bin" "#L"fromelf --m32combined -o "$L@L.srec" "#L"
原创
2022-12-07 01:01:47
124阅读
# 生成bin文件的方法及示例
在Java开发中,有时候我们需要将数据以二进制的形式保存到文件中,这时候就需要生成bin文件。本文将介绍如何使用Java生成bin文件,并且给出代码示例。
## 什么是bin文件
bin文件是二进制文件的简称,它以二进制形式存储数据,和普通的文本文件不同。在计算机中,所有的数据最终都会以二进制的形式存储和处理。生成bin文件就是将数据按照二进制格式写入文件中。
原创
2024-02-01 08:11:21
576阅读
# Python生成bin文件入门指南
作为一名刚入行的开发者,你可能会遇到需要生成bin文件的情况,比如在嵌入式开发中。Python作为一种强大的编程语言,也可以用来生成bin文件。下面,我将为你详细介绍如何使用Python生成bin文件。
## 1. 准备工作
在开始之前,你需要确保你的开发环境中已经安装了Python。你可以在[Python官网](
## 2. 流程概览
下面是使用
原创
2024-07-21 10:29:42
402阅读
故事背景出于好奇,当下扫描excel读取数据进数据库 or 导出数据库数据组成excel的功能层出不穷,代码也是前篇一律,poi或者easy excel两种SDK的二次利用带来了各种封装方法。那么为何不能直接扫描excel后根据列的属性名与行数据的属性建立SQL数据表,并将数据插入到数据表中,再通过前端与用户交互进行SQL组装,得到用户想要的数据结果。模块架构图采取原始的数据库信息读取,
所以上面命令的针对的目录关系就显而易见了,快去试试吧。在下图的设置中加入下面的命令即可。
原创
2022-08-20 00:41:19
4176阅读
一、Android系统中运行没有GUI的java程序的方法1.Android系统中的虚拟机不是java了,而是dalvikvm,它接收的是.dex格式的文件,所有.class文件需要转换成.dex文件后才能在Android上运行。使用dx命令可以将.class文件转换为.dex格式的文件,这个命令是Android编译环境自带的,使用前需要先配置Android的编译环境。测试程序Hello.java
转载
2023-08-26 18:31:48
334阅读
在MySQL数据库中,mysql-bin.000001、mysql- bin.000002等文件是数据库的操作日志,例如UPDATE一个表,或者DELETE一些数据,即使该语句没有匹配的数据,这个命令也会存储到日志文件中,还包括每个语句执行的时间,也会记录进去的。
原创
2021-09-01 10:11:27
1192阅读
It is written in JavaScript,crud for mysql.You can also use transactions very easily.mysqls 一款专为node.js生成sql语句的插件,链式调用,使用灵活。支持生成sql语法,也支持生成语法之后直接调用,支持事物等特性。API参考很流行的ThinkPHP模型API。mysqls是笔者在开发过程中为了更简单、
转载
2024-03-05 08:07:44
65阅读